--- title: "TCP - IP Properties (Protocols Tab) | Microsoft Docs" ms.custom: "" ms.date: "03/06/2017" ms.prod: "sql-server-2014" ms.reviewer: "" ms.technology: configuration ms.topic: conceptual helpviewer_keywords: - "TCP/IP [SQL Server], configuration options" ms.assetid: 007638fc-3a24-4460-adbe-545ded5d6f88 author: stevestein ms.author: sstein manager: craigg --- # TCP - IP Properties (Protocols Tab) Use the **TCP/IP Properties** dialog box to configure the options for the TCP/IP protocol. Click **TCP/IP** in the left pane, to show individual IP address configurations in the details pane. Microsoft [!INCLUDE[ssNoVersion](../../includes/ssnoversion-md.md)] must be restarted before the changes take effect. ## Options **Enabled** Possible values are **Yes** and **No**. **Keep Alive** Specify the interval (milliseconds) in which keep-alive packets are transmitted to verify that the computer at the remote end of a connection is still available. **Listen All** Specify whether SQL Server will listen on all the IP addresses that are bound to network cards on the computer. If set to **No**, configure each IP address separately using the properties dialog box for each IP address. If set to **Yes**, the settings of the **IPAll** properties box will apply to all IP addresses. Default value is **Yes**. **No Delay** [!INCLUDE[ssNoVersion](../../includes/ssnoversion-md.md)] does not implement changes to this property. ## See Also [Choosing a Network Protocol](../../../2014/tools/configuration-manager/choosing-a-network-protocol.md) [Creating a Valid Connection String Using TCP IP](../../../2014/tools/configuration-manager/creating-a-valid-connection-string-using-tcp-ip.md)
